Output fb673a836fa0d2bf0e2da6ac39a141a9fc34f4c75f353f00ece5adaf24d19aa0:0

value
982698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bbc4099d264f9dc4f490d85386569dad3c3219 OP_EQUAL
address
3B4DnJeEiATk6JEuY3fqbBtLyUBHyTNnwA
transaction
fb673a836fa0d2bf0e2da6ac39a141a9fc34f4c75f353f00ece5adaf24d19aa0
spent
true